I really like this series. In this one, Lindsey confronts modern day "pirates" looking for treasure on the Thumb Island and an ex-boyfriend who keeps hounding her to get back together. Plenty of adventure, a good mystery, and romantic entanglements. I really hope she can resolve her relationship problems very soon! My heart hurt a bit at the end of this one. Third book in the series and while I still enjoy the characters, I'm not too enamored of the mystery itself. Too many random out of town suspects . On a weird side note, the blurb on the back says that Lindsay's neighbor Charlie is a chief suspect and that's why she gets involved. At no point is he ever considered a suspect so that was a bit confusing.
